Western political circles and mainstream media don’t talk about the violation of the agreements signed by Ukraine, the Minsk agreements. Ukraine is not complying with those agreements signed by former president Petro Poroshenko, that have been on the table for 7 years, and Donbas is not getting the special status required by this agreement.
This is a recurring pro-Kremlin disinformation narrative accusing Kyiv of non-adherence to the 2014 Minsk Agreements and the 2019 Normandy accords. Through this accusation, this disinformation aims to frame Ukraine as the party to blame for the recent escalation in Donbas, exempting Russia of any responsibility for its military buildup at the border.
In reality, Moscow-backed separatists have been mounting tensions in Donbas over the recent weeks under the pretext that Ukrainian troops are planning an offensive. Four Ukrainian soldiers were killed on 26 March 2021, which is the largest daily death toll for government troops since the fragile truce that took effect last July. Nonetheless, Moscow and its proxies in Donbas keep on accusing Kyiv of continually breaking the truce and preparing for a full-scale attack.
Since end of March / early April 2021, Russia has started sending troops near to the Ukrainian border and increased bellicose language in key Russian state media. The EU's High Representative for Foreign Affairs and Security Policy, Josep Borrell, has expressed 'severe concern' over Russian military activity near Ukraine's border.
See also the Statement of 12 April by the G7 Foreign Ministers and the EU High Representative here. It addresses the "large-scale troop movements, without prior notification, represent threatening and destabilising activities. We call on Russia to cease its provocations and to immediately de-escalate tensions in line with its international obligations."
